Home
last modified time | relevance | path

Searched refs:needFlushFb (Results 1 - 22 of 22) sorted by relevance

/drivers/peripheral/display/composer/vdi_base/src/
H A Dhdi_display.cpp167 int32_t HdiDisplay::PrepareDisplayLayers(bool *needFlushFb) in PrepareDisplayLayers() argument
192 *needFlushFb = true; in PrepareDisplayLayers()
H A Dhdi_session.cpp170 static int32_t PrepareDisplayLayers(uint32_t devId, bool *needFlushFb) in PrepareDisplayLayers() argument
173 DISPLAY_CHK_RETURN((needFlushFb == nullptr), DISPLAY_NULL_PTR, DISPLAY_LOGE("needFlushFb is nullptr")); in PrepareDisplayLayers()
174 return HdiSession::GetInstance().CallDisplayFunction(devId, &HdiDisplay::PrepareDisplayLayers, needFlushFb); in PrepareDisplayLayers()
H A Ddisplay_composer_vdi_impl.cpp227 int32_t DisplayComposerVdiImpl::PrepareDisplayLayers(uint32_t devId, bool& needFlushFb) in PrepareDisplayLayers() argument
229 int32_t ec = HdiSession::GetInstance().CallDisplayFunction(devId, &HdiDisplay::PrepareDisplayLayers, &needFlushFb); in PrepareDisplayLayers()
/drivers/peripheral/display/hal/default_standard/src/display_device/core/
H A Dhdi_display.cpp175 int32_t HdiDisplay::PrepareDisplayLayers(bool *needFlushFb) in PrepareDisplayLayers() argument
196 *needFlushFb = true; in PrepareDisplayLayers()
H A Dhdi_display.h88 virtual int32_t PrepareDisplayLayers(bool *needFlushFb);
H A Dhdi_session.cpp146 static int32_t PrepareDisplayLayers(uint32_t devId, bool *needFlushFb) in PrepareDisplayLayers() argument
149 DISPLAY_CHK_RETURN((needFlushFb == nullptr), DISPLAY_NULL_PTR, DISPLAY_LOGE("needFlushFb is nullptr")); in PrepareDisplayLayers()
150 return HdiSession::GetInstance().CallDisplayFunction(devId, &HdiDisplay::PrepareDisplayLayers, needFlushFb); in PrepareDisplayLayers()
/drivers/peripheral/display/composer/vdi_base/include/
H A Dhdi_display.h93 virtual int32_t PrepareDisplayLayers(bool *needFlushFb);
H A Ddisplay_composer_vdi_impl.h60 virtual int32_t PrepareDisplayLayers(uint32_t devId, bool& needFlushFb) override;
/drivers/interface/display/composer/v1_0/display_command/
H A Ddisplay_cmd_requester.h93 int32_t PrepareDisplayLayers(uint32_t devId, bool &needFlushFb) in PrepareDisplayLayers() argument
115 needFlushFb = *(reinterpret_cast<bool *>(data)); in PrepareDisplayLayers()
741 int32_t OnReplyPrepareDisplayLayers(CommandDataUnpacker& replyUnpacker, bool &needFlushFb) in OnReplyPrepareDisplayLayers() argument
747 retBool = replyUnpacker.ReadBool(needFlushFb); in OnReplyPrepareDisplayLayers()
748 DISPLAY_CHK_RETURN(retBool == false, HDF_FAILURE, HDF_LOGE("%{public}s: read needFlushFb failed", __func__)); in OnReplyPrepareDisplayLayers()
799 bool needFlushFb; in ProcessUnpackCmd() local
804 ret = OnReplyPrepareDisplayLayers(replyUnpacker, needFlushFb); in ProcessUnpackCmd()
808 ret = fn(&needFlushFb); in ProcessUnpackCmd()
/drivers/peripheral/display/interfaces/include/
H A Ddisplay_device.h290 * @param needFlushFb Indicates the pointer that specifies whether the graphics service needs to reset the display
299 int32_t (*PrepareDisplayLayers)(uint32_t devId, bool *needFlushFb);
/drivers/peripheral/display/composer/hdi_service/include/
H A Didisplay_composer_vdi.h67 virtual int32_t PrepareDisplayLayers(uint32_t devId, bool& needFlushFb) = 0;
/drivers/peripheral/display/hal/default_standard/src/display_device/
H A Ddisplay_composer_vdi_impl.h60 virtual int32_t PrepareDisplayLayers(uint32_t devId, bool& needFlushFb) override;
H A Ddisplay_composer_vdi_impl.cpp243 int32_t DisplayComposerVdiImpl::PrepareDisplayLayers(uint32_t devId, bool& needFlushFb) in PrepareDisplayLayers() argument
246 int32_t ec = composerModel_->CallDisplayFunction(devId, &HdiDisplay::PrepareDisplayLayers, &needFlushFb); in PrepareDisplayLayers()
/drivers/peripheral/display/composer/test/fuzztest/device_fuzzer/
H A Ddevice_fuzzer.cpp174 bool needFlushFb = GetRandBoolValue(GetData<uint32_t>()); in TestPrepareDisplayLayers() local
175 int32_t ret = g_composerInterface->PrepareDisplayLayers(devId, needFlushFb); in TestPrepareDisplayLayers()
/drivers/peripheral/display/hdi_service/device/src/server/
H A Ddisplay_device_service.cpp99 int32_t DisplayDeviceService::PrepareDisplayLayers(uint32_t devId, bool &needFlushFb) in PrepareDisplayLayers() argument
101 return displayDevice_->PrepareDisplayLayers(devId, &needFlushFb); in PrepareDisplayLayers()
H A Ddisplay_device_host_driver.cpp489 bool needFlushFb = false; in PrepareDisplayLayers() local
491 int32_t ret = device_->PrepareDisplayLayers(devId, needFlushFb); in PrepareDisplayLayers()
496 if (!reply->WriteBool(needFlushFb)) { in PrepareDisplayLayers()
497 DISPLAY_LOG("error: server write needFlushFb into data failed"); in PrepareDisplayLayers()
/drivers/interface/display/composer/v1_0/hdi_impl/
H A Ddisplay_composer_hdi_impl.h357 virtual int32_t PrepareDisplayLayers(uint32_t devId, bool& needFlushFb) override
360 return ToDispErrCode(req_->PrepareDisplayLayers(devId, needFlushFb));
/drivers/interface/display/composer/v1_0/include/
H A Didisplay_composer_interface.h569 * @param needFlushFb Indicates the pointer that specifies whether the graphics service needs to reset the display
578 virtual int32_t PrepareDisplayLayers(uint32_t devId, bool& needFlushFb) = 0;
/drivers/peripheral/display/hdi_service/device/include/interfaces/
H A Didisplay_device.h56 virtual int32_t PrepareDisplayLayers(uint32_t devId, bool &needFlushFb) = 0;
/drivers/peripheral/display/hdi_service/device/include/proxy/
H A Ddisplay_device_proxy.h50 int32_t PrepareDisplayLayers(uint32_t devId, bool &needFlushFb) override;
/drivers/peripheral/display/hdi_service/device/include/server/
H A Ddisplay_device_service.h46 int32_t PrepareDisplayLayers(uint32_t devId, bool &needFlushFb) override;
/drivers/peripheral/display/hdi_service/device/src/proxy/display_device_proxy/
H A Ddisplay_device_proxy.cpp454 int32_t DisplayDeviceProxy::PrepareDisplayLayers(uint32_t devId, bool &needFlushFb) in PrepareDisplayLayers() argument
469 if (!data.WriteUint32(needFlushFb)) { in PrepareDisplayLayers()
479 needFlushFb = reply.ReadBool(); in PrepareDisplayLayers()

Completed in 22 milliseconds